Treated wood siding repair involves fixing and restoring wood panels that have been treated to resist rot, insects, and weather damage. Over time, even the most durable treated wood can develop issues such as cracking, warping, or splitting due to exposure to the elements. Skilled service providers assess the extent of damage, replace damaged sections, and ensure the siding is properly sealed and protected. This process helps maintain the appearance and structural integrity of the property, preventing minor issues from escalating into more costly repairs.

This service is essential for addressing common problems like rotting, termite damage, and moisture infiltration that can compromise the siding’s effectiveness. When treated wood siding shows signs of deterioration-such as discoloration, soft spots, or visible mold-repair work can restore its strength and appearance. Repairing rather than replacing siding can be a practical solution for homeowners who want to preserve the original look of their home while avoiding more extensive renovation projects. Proper repair also helps prevent issues like drafts, water leaks, and further wood decay.

Homeowners typically seek treated wood siding repair services when they notice signs of damage or wear that threaten the siding’s protective qualities. These signs include peeling paint, visible cracks, or areas where the wood feels soft or spongy. Addressing these issues promptly can extend the lifespan of the siding and improve the overall appearance of a home. What types of damage can Treated Wood Siding repair address? Local contractors can handle issues such as rot, warping, insect damage, and surface deterioration to restore the integrity of Treated Wood Siding.

How do professionals typically repair Treated Wood Siding? Repairs often involve replacing damaged panels, sealing gaps, and applying protective finishes to prevent future issues.

Can Treated Wood Siding be repaired instead of replaced? Yes, many types of damage can be effectively repaired, helping to extend the lifespan of existing siding when handled by experienced service providers.

What are common signs that Treated Wood Siding needs repair? Visible rot, cracking, peeling paint, or insect infestations are indicators that professional repair services may be needed.
